Personally I've always thought it a bit daft to store passwords etc online - what could be a more appealing place to hack?

Same reason I use KeePass, not LastPass. My computer in of itself isn't really an attractive target. Even if my machine is compromised, it's probably easier just to keylog me than it is to break the password database.

A cloud service brimming with username/password combos? If I were a hacker, I'd be frothing at the mouth to get a bite out of that.

Posted
Onelogin doesn't really work the same way as last pass though. It was more for sso credentials so a lot was not going to be encrypted clientside like last pass. Nothing is unencrypted on last pass servers and it's all done clientside.
